String Theory Group at YMSCPostdoctoral Fellow, Yau Mathematical Sciences Center, Tsinghua University
String theory, supersymmetric field theory, topological field theory, vertex operator algebras, and the 3d-3d correspondence.
Myungbo Shim studies topological and algebraic structures in supersymmetric field theory and string theory, especially where three-dimensional gauge theories meet vertex algebras and integrable systems. Recent work on affine W-algebras and Miura maps from 3d N=4 quiver gauge theories develops the algebraic side of this correspondence, while work on Teichmuller TQFT, tetrahedron equations, q-opers, and open spin chains develops the integrable and topological side. The broader theme is that dualities of supersymmetric field theories can often be made concrete as relations among TQFTs, vertex algebras, and quantum-integrable models.
